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
693 94604675475 274263178 0787136
7917 42883
7917 42883
985 4512468 774064684 57067560 990253
All about undefined
Interested in learning more?
7917 42883
985 4512468 774064684 57067560 990253
See more
594580182 71774
320646431 061454 95
See more
124393 326395177
39366 36735683296 8087902
See more